My "old" camera was a Minolta Dimage 7 but it took so long time to auto-focus (over 5 sec) so I decided to change to a 300 D which does the job in less then 1 sec. and now I can also take a 4 pic:s in a row. I plan to take nice pic:s with it. :-) The price included a 95-200 lens. I will bring the camera, including my Sony HandyCam video to Bulgaria in about 4 weeks so I have to learn to take nice pics fast. What I'm wondering about is why there are symbols and functions for portrait, lanscape aso. I can't see any difference between that and photographing in total auto mode. Canon also have a P(rogram) mode and the manual says that there isn't really any difference between P and fully Auto so why do they have a P mode? B> Glad you broke the ice!
